    How to Use

    Using a video downloader can vary slightly depending on the platform or software you choose. Most video downloaders operate under a similar mechanism:

    1. Install the Software: Download and install a reputable video downloader application.
    2. Copy the Video URL: Navigate to the video you want to download and copy its URL from the address bar.
    3. Paste the URL: Open the video downloader application and paste the URL into the designated field.
    4. Select Format and Quality: Choose the desired video format (e.g., MP4, AVI) and resolution (e.g., 480p, 1080p).
    5. Download: Click on the download button to initiate the process. Once complete, you can find the video in your specified output folder.

    Limitations

    While video downloaders are powerful tools, they are not without limitations:

    • Legal Issues: Downloading copyrighted material without permission is illegal in many jurisdictions.
    • Quality Constraints: Certain downloaders may not provide high-resolution options for some videos.
    • Platform Restrictions: Some video platforms have measures in place to prevent downloads.
    • File Size: Large video files can consume significant storage space on your device.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    1. Is it legal to download videos?

    Downloading videos may infringe copyright laws if the content is not explicitly allowed. Always check the terms and conditions of the platform.

    2. Can I download videos from any website?

    Not all websites permit downloads. Some sites have built-in restrictions, particularly on copyrighted content.

    3. What formats can I download videos in?

    Most video downloaders allow options such as MP4, AVI, MOV, and more. Always check for the best format for your device.

    4. What is the best way to ensure video quality?

    Choose the highest resolution available for download and ensure you have a stable internet connection while downloading.

    5. What should I do if my download fails?

    Check your internet connection, verify the video URL, or try another downloader as a last resort.
